1967 DAF 44 vs. 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ette
To start off, 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ette is newer by 37 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 DAF 44.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 DAF 44 would be higher. At 3,392 cc (6 cylinders), 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ette (185 HP) has 151 more horse power than 1967 DAF 44. (34 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ette should accelerate faster than 1967 DAF 44.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ette weights approximately 1036 kg more than 1967 DAF 44.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ette (285 Nm) has 220 more torque (in Nm) than 1967 DAF 44. (65 Nm). This means 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1967 DAF 44.
Compare all specifications:
1967 DAF 44 | 2004 Oldsmobile Silhouette | |
Make | DAF | Oldsmobile |
Model | 44 | Silhouette |
Year Released | 1967 | 2004 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 844 cc | 3392 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 34 HP | 185 HP |
Torque | 65 Nm | 285 Nm |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 7 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 755 kg | 1791 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3890 mm | 5120 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1550 mm | 1840 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1390 mm | 1740 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2260 mm | 3050 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 33 L | 95 L |
